Street Dogs is a Hardcore punk act. Their sound grew out of Wayne Kramer, Flogging Molly, The Mighty Mighty Bosstones, Sick of It All and Mad Caddies. Those roots explain a lot about how Street Dogs arrange songs and choose their tones. They run in the same orbit as Flatfoot 56, Off with Their Heads, The Casualties, The Business and No Fun at All, sharing audiences, venues and reference points rather than a straight line of influence. Their influence carried into Dropkick Murphys, where the same ideas turn up rearranged for a later generation.
